      Royal College of Pharmaceutical Education and Research Application Process

      The application procedure for the Royal College of Pharmaceutical Education and Research, Malegaon, varies with the course:

      Royal College of Pharmaceutical Education and Research B.Pharm Application Process

      • Completed 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ology / Mathematics from any recognised board
      • Application through a centralised admission process conducted by the state authorities for pharmacy admissions
      • Qualification in the relevant entrance exam, such as MHT-CET for students from Maharashtra or NEET for the All India quota.
      • If shortlisted based on entrance exam scores, participate in the counselling process.
      • All mark sheets, entrance exam scorecards, and identity proof are to be submitted.
      • Admission fees are to be paid upon seat allocation.

      Royal College of Pharmaceutical Education and Research M.Pharm Application Process

      • The candidate must have a B.Pharm degree from a PCI-approved institution.
      • Apply through the centralised admission process for postgraduate pharmacy programmes in Maharashtra.
      • Qualify for theGPAT (Graduate Pharmacy Aptitude Test) or its state-level entrance exam equivalent
      • Counselling to the candidates in the entrance exam merit list
      • Submission of mark sheets (B.Pharm), GPAT Score card and relevant other certificates on or before allotment of the seat
      • Completion of Admission formalities with seat allotment, including fee remittance

      Royal College of Pharmaceutical Education and Research B. Pharm Admission Process

      The Bachelor of Pharmacy at the Royal College of Pharmaceutical Education and Research, Malegaon, has an approved intake of 60 seats. Royal College of Pharmaceutical Education and Research admission to the B. Pharm course is given based on performance in the entrance examination relevant to the course and 10+2 marks.       Royal College of Pharmaceutical Education and Research Documents Required

      • 10th class marks sheet/Passing Certificate 
      • 12th marks sheet/passing Certificate 
      • Scorecardof the entrance exam.
      • Degree certificate and mark sheets of B. Pharm for M. Pharm applicants
      • Domicile certificate, if applicable
      • Category certificate, if the applicant is applying under the reserved category
      • Valid ID proof
      • Recent passport-size photographs
